Thru Week 12

It’s now a win streak! In what was one of the coldest games I can remember attending at Lavell Edwards Stadium, BYU summarily dispatched the UNLV Rebels 45-23.

The cold also go to both teams as UNLV’s last score came with 1:57 remaining in the 3rd quarter, and BYU’s was just 0:19 seconds later. The teams combined for seven punts and kneel down the rest of the game.

So let’s see how BYU is doing compared to opponent season averages. As always, I'm comparing the BYU game to the opponents' season averages (with the BYU game removed from those calculations).

Season Totals:
BYU has held four of ten opponents below their scoring averages.BYU has held eight of ten opponents below their rushing averages.
BYU has held three of ten opponents below their passing averages.
BYU has held four of ten opponents below their total offense averages.

BYU has held six of ten opponents below the PER averages.
BYU has score more points against nine of ten opponents scoring defenses.
BYU has gained more rushing yards against seven of ten opponents rushing defenses.
BYU has gained more passing yards against seven of ten opponents passing defenses.
BYU has gained more total yards against seven of ten opponents total defenses.
BYU has been above seven of ten opposing PER defenses.


BYU Averages vs Opponent Averages: (strictly comparing BYU averages vs Combined Opponent averages)
BYU’s Scoring Defense average is holding opponents 0.1 points (26.8 ) below their combined scoring average (26.9).
BYU’s Rushing Defense average is holding teams 35.9 yards (121.5) below their combined rushing average (157.4)

BYU’s Passing Defense average is allowing teams 43.6 yards (276.7) above their combined passing average (233.1)
BYU’s Total Defense average is allowing teams 7.6 (398.2) above their combined total offense average (390.6)

BYU’s Defensive PER is holding teams 3.1 points (124.46) below their combined PER average (126.57).
BYU’s Scoring average is 7.0 points (32.8 ) above their opponents combined scoring defense (25.9).
BYU’s Rushing Offense average is 32.2 yards (191.5) above their opponents combined rushing defense (159.3).
BYU’s Passing Offense average is 33.8 yards (260.8 ) above their opponents combined passing defense (227.0).
BYU’s Total Offense average is 66.0 yards (452.3) above their opponents combined total defense (386.3).
BYU’s PER average is 9.6 PER points (132.55) above their opponents combined PER defense (122.97)
